home of 67 years. Mr. Good was born Mar. 16, 1917 in Putnam Co. to
Opal I. and Faye A. (Little) Good. He was a graduate of Amo High
School and attended Central Normal College in Danville. He was
involved in all areas of farming, grain, dairy, cattle, and hogs. He
also owned and operated Don Good Trucking. A member of the Hadley
Friends Church, he served as a trustee on it's cemetery board. He was
a member of the Danville Masonic Lodge #26, and a former member of
the Sahara Grotto Horse Patrol in Indpls.., and the Danville Optimist
Club. Services: 10:30 a.m. Tues. Mar. 11 at the Hadley Friends Church
with visitation 3:16 p.m.-8 p.m. Mon. Mar. 10 in the Weaver &
Randolph Funeral Home, Danville. Burial- Hadley Cemetery. Survivors:
wife, Mildred (Stanley) Good; children, Carolyn (Mike) Goff - Marion,
IN, Virginia (Bob) Moore - Danville, Larry (Patti) Good - Ottawa, IL,
Kathy (Al) Jerves - Casteau, Belgium, Garry (Pam) Good, Bloomington,
IL, and Mike (Kelly) Good - Lake Worth, FL; 14 grandchildren, 18
great-grandchildren, 2 great great grandchildren, and a sister,
Elisabeth Faye Good - Indpls. Contributions to the Hadley Friends
Church.
